New and facile one‐pot approach for the syntheses of polysubstituted pyrrol‐2‐one, furan‐2‐one and tetrahydropyridines (THPDs) from easily available starting materials using lemon juice as a green catalyst is presented. The synthesis of diverse furan‐2‐one and pyrrol‐2‐one derivatives were achieved from dialkyl acetylenedicarboxylates, different amines and aldehydes in high yields and short reaction times by employing 0.25 mL of lemon juice at 110 oC under solvent‐free condition. THPDs, on the other hand, were synthesized via the reaction among β‐ketoesters, various aromatic aldehydes, and amines in the presence of 0.25 mL of lemon juice in ethanol at room temperature. The molecular structure of compound pyrrol‐2‐one 7e and THPD 10g were confirmed by the single crystal X‐ray analysis. Application of cheap and green catalyst, environmentally benign reaction condition, good to high yields, applicable to a broad range of substrates and no column chromatographic separation are some salient features of this protocol.
